比特币钱包自己做?实现DIY比特币钱包的步骤和

                  时间:2024-02-26 07:37:10

                  主页 > 区块链钱包 >

                      比特币钱包是比特币交易的必备工具之一,每一个拥有比特币的人都需要一个安全、可靠的钱包来存储和管理比特币。如果你对自己的技术有信心,你可以考虑自己实现DIY比特币钱包。然而,在制作比特币钱包之前,你需要了解一些基本的知识和技能,因为安全性一直是比特币钱包制作的核心和首要考虑因素。

                      比特币钱包DIY的优势是什么?

                      如果你是一名技术人员,制作比特币钱包DIY是一项非常具有挑战性的任务。而且,自己制作比特币钱包还有许多优势,例如: 1. 安全性更有保障:自己制作的钱包比第三方提供的钱包更具有隐私性和安全性。 2. 友情价格:制作比特币钱包的成本比市面上售卖的钱包低得多。 3. 可定制性:自己设计钱包能够满足个性化需求,例如增加对其他加密货币的支持或增加更多安全特性等。

                      自己制作比特币钱包的步骤是什么?

                      比特币钱包自己做?实现DIY比特币钱包的步骤和技巧 制作比特币钱包需要具备如下步骤: 1. 确定钱包类型:包括硬件钱包和软件钱包两种,选择合适的类型,确定所需要的硬件和软件。 2. 设计钱包的功能和特性:在设计钱包前,需要确定所需要的功能和特性。 3. 写入控制程序:这是自己制作比特币钱包的关键步骤,比特币钱包控制程序需要通过软件编程来实现。 4. 完成物理设计并组装:如果你选择物理钱包,你需要将控制程序写入物理设备中,完成钱包物理部分的设计和组装工作。 5. 测试你的钱包:确保钱包的功能在实际使用中能够正常地运行。

                      如何保证自制比特币钱包的安全性?

                      安全性一直是比特币钱包制作的核心和首要考虑因素,以下三点是制作比特币钱包DIY过程中需要注意的安全性 1. 防止黑客攻击:因为黑客可以通过攻击代码获取私钥,所以你需要确保控制程序和物理部分不容易被破解。 2. 满足密码复杂度要求:比特币钱包需要高度安全的密码,所以你需要保证密码的复杂度很高。 3. 隐私保护:你需要确保比特币交易的匿名性,同时保护和保密钱包地址和私钥。

                      物理钱包和软件钱包的优缺点是什么?

                      比特币钱包自己做?实现DIY比特币钱包的步骤和技巧 自制比特币钱包的类型有两种:硬件钱包和软件钱包。下面让我们来看看它们的优缺点: 1. 硬件钱包:硬件钱包是存储在物理设备中的钱包,可以存储私钥和备份助记词,最大的优点是安全性非常高。但是这种钱包很贵,且功能有限,只支持比特币和其他少数几种加密货币。 2. 软件钱包:软件钱包是安装在电脑、手机或其他移动设备上的钱包。软件钱包比硬件钱包便宜,而且有更多的功能和支持更多的加密货币。但是因为存储在软件中,所以安全性较低,容易被黑客攻击。

                      硬件钱包的材料和组装步骤是什么?

                      硬件钱包是一种物理设备,不同的硬件钱包可能需要不同的材料和组装步骤,下面是硬件钱包的基本组装流程: 1. 准备钱包设备:钱包设备需要准备USB接口、屏幕、加密芯片和电池,你需要确保这些部件都已准备妥当。 2. 验证芯片和屏幕的可靠性:硬件钱包的核心部分是控制芯片和屏幕,一个没有被攻击过的芯片和屏幕可以提供更高的安全性。 3. 安装控制程序:将控制程序写入芯片中,根据设备的不同,你需要采用不同的方式进行写入,例如BIP39助记词或Firmware。 4. 完成物理设计并组装:如果你选择物理钱包,你需要将控制程序写入物理设备中,完成钱包物理部分的设计和组装工作。 5. 测试你的钱包:确保钱包的功能在实际使用中能够正常地运行。

                      自己制作比特币钱包需要掌握哪些编程技能?

                      自制比特币钱包需要掌握多种编程技能,包括: 1. 区块链技术:熟悉比特币和区块链的技术,包括了解区块链的底层设计,具体的交易和挖矿过程等。 2. 编程语言:会编程语言,例如C ,Python,JavaScript,Java等。 3. 安全协议:了解安全协议以及安全性能方面的问题。 4. 完整性检验:知道如何检验交易的完整性是至关重要的。

                      如何确保自己制作的比特币钱包的广泛性?

                      选用广泛的比特币协议和开源代码库来确保钱包的广泛性是至关重要的。这样可以帮助开发者添加多种不同的安全功能,从而添加更多的分支。为了确保钱包受到更多人的欢迎,你还可以将它上传到开源存储库,让其他人共享,这可以帮助提高钱包的流行度和可用性。同时,也应该定期维护自己的钱包,及时更新升级钱包的功能,随时关注钱包安全问题。